I just returned a PNY 256 MB flash drive to Staples
because Windows XP said it couldn't identify it. I
replaced it withj a Sandisk CruzerMicro. On the very first
plug n play, it was recognized. I loaded a few midi files
into it. On a subsequent plug in, I got the same message.
The unit was not recognized ( Unknown Device )

It works just fine with my laptop running XP home edition.
What in the world is going on? Any fixes would be
appreciated. I tried downloading th win9 drivers, I did,
but when I attempted to install them, XP detected a win9
driver and refused to unzip it. Wow, how complicated can
it get?

Try updating the USB drivers on your computer. I would use Everest Home
from www.lavalys.com to find out what motherboard you have and it will
provide a link to the latest chipset drivers for you ;)
